THE WEEKEND: Sneak Peak at the Presidential Campaign

Your browser doesn’t support HTML5 audio

Getty Images

UTEP Political Scientist Gregory Rocha joins us to talk about the current presidential campaign.  The field of candidates has been whittled down from 17 to 2, and both Donald Trump and Hillary Clinton have very low approval ratings. Rocha also talks about Clinton's recent health issues, how millennials might be voting, and why there are new battleground states that could decide the race.

Aired Sept. 17, 2016
